What is the  structure of Leukotrienes?

The structure of Leukotrienes consists of the “G” protein family and a couple of receptors”. as well as constructed inflammatory chemicals that are effective when connected with the allergen or the allergy trigger. Leukotrienes belongs to the eicosanoid family and it is basically an inflammatory mediator whose structure is constituted through oxidation of arachidonic acid through enzymatic activity of arachidonate 5-Lipoxygenase.

What is the role of Leukotrienes in the human immune system?

Leukotrienes primarily affect “G protein-coupled receptors”. They might even act on sensors triggered by the peroxisome proliferator. Leukotrienes play a role in asthma as well as allergic conditions, as well as in the maintenance of inflammatory conditions. Asthma is usually treated with leukotriene receptor antagonists like montelukast as well as zafirlukast. “5-lipoxygenase” appears to play a function in cardiovascular as well as “neuropsychiatric diseases”, according to new studies. Leukotrienes have a crucial role in the proinflammatory reaction. Several, like LTB4, have such a chemotactic impact on moving macrophages, assisting in the delivery of the required cells to the area. Leukotrienes can cause “bronchospasm” and enhance capillary permeability.
